The narrative explores Argentina's decline from a promising liberal democracy to instability, countering the notion that this downturn is mysterious. Julia Rodriguez argues that the country's challenges stem from misguided efforts to "civilize" it through progressivism, health initiatives, and public order. By analyzing these schemes, she reveals how the very attempts to foster advancement led to unintended consequences, reshaping the nation's trajectory and understanding of its historical context.
